Roofing in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roof to identify potential issues and assess its overall condition. These inspections typically include examining the roofing materials, checking for signs of damage or wear, and evaluating the integrity of flashing, gutters, and ventilation systems. The goal is to detect problems early, such as leaks, missing shingles, or structural concerns, before they develop into more costly repairs or cause significant property damage. Professional inspectors use specialized tools and expertise to provide an accurate evaluation, helping property owners make informed decisions about repairs, maintenance, or replacement.
These services are essential for addressing common roofing problems that can compromise a building’s safety and efficiency. For example, identifying leaks can prevent water damage to the interior and structural deterioration. Detecting damaged or missing shingles can reduce the risk of further weather-related harm, especially during storms or heavy rainfall. Inspections also help uncover issues with flashing or ventilation that could lead to moisture buildup or energy inefficiency. By catching these problems early, property owners can avoid extensive repairs and prolong the lifespan of their roofs.

Inspection Fees - The cost for a roofing inspection typically ranges from $150 to $400, depending on the size and complexity of the roof. Larger or more complex roofs may cost more, with some inspections reaching up to $500. Local service providers can provide detailed quotes based on specific needs.
Additional Service Costs - If repairs or minor fixes are identified, costs can vary from $200 to $1,000 or more. The final price depends on the extent of the repairs needed and the materials required, with some projects costing over $2,000 for extensive work.
Comprehensive Roof Evaluation - A thorough roof evaluation, including detailed reporting, can cost between $300 and $700. This service often includes assessments of the roof’s condition, potential issues, and recommendations for maintenance or repairs.
Cost Factors - Prices for roofing inspection services vary based on factors like roof size, pitch, and accessibility. Additional services such as drone inspections or thermal imaging may incur extra charges, influencing overall costs in the Cook County area.

What is a roofing inspection service? A roofing inspection service involves a professional evaluating the condition of a roof to identify potential issues, damage, or areas needing maintenance.
How often should a roof be inspected? It is recommended to have a roof inspected at least once a year or after severe weather events to ensure its integrity.
What are common signs that a roof needs an inspection? Signs include missing or damaged shingles, leaks, water stains on ceilings, or visible wear and tear on the roof surface.
Do roofing inspection services include damage assessments? Yes, they typically include evaluating existing damage, potential problem areas, and overall roof health.
How can a roofing inspection benefit property owners? Regular inspections can help detect issues early, potentially preventing costly repairs and prolonging the roof’s lifespan.
